The Team

Upstart's Bank Technology team builds the internal platforms, security automation, and operational systems that enable Upstart Bank to operate securely, efficiently, and at scale. The team partners closely with stakeholders across risk, legal, compliance, security, and operations to create software solutions that support the bank's growth as a licensed financial institution.

As a Principal Software Engineer, you will provide technical leadership across a growing portfolio of internal platforms and automation systems. You will drive architectural direction, solve complex technical challenges, and establish engineering patterns that enable the team to deliver secure, scalable, and maintainable solutions for the bank's most critical operational functions.

How you'll make an impact

  • Lead the architecture, design, and implementation of internal platforms, security automation systems, and workflow tooling that support Upstart Bank operations.
  • Establish scalable engineering patterns, technical standards, and system designs that enable long-term platform growth and maintainability.
  • Partner with stakeholders across risk, compliance, legal, operations, and engineering to translate complex business requirements into durable software solutions.
  • Design and oversee relational data models, authorization systems, integrations, and platform services that support secure and reliable operations.
  • Identify and mitigate technical risks, making thoughtful decisions around system architecture, platform investments, and build-versus-buy tradeoffs.
  • Mentor engineers through technical leadership, architectural reviews, design documentation, and engineering best practices.
  • Drive technical strategy for internal platforms and automation initiatives as the bank expands its operational and regulatory capabilities.

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ics, or a related field (or equivalent practical experience) and 8+ years of software engineering experience.
  • Experience designing, building, and operating large-scale production software systems and web applications.
  • Experience leading architecture and technical design for distributed systems, platform services, or internal software platforms.
  • Experience designing relational database schemas, APIs, integrations, authentication systems, and role-based access control frameworks.
  • Experience partnering with cross-functional stakeholders to deliver software solutions supporting operational, compliance, security, or business-critical workflows.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Knowledge of TypeScript, Node.js, Next.js, Prisma, or similar modern application frameworks.
  • Experience building security automation, governance, risk and compliance (GRC) platforms, or operational workflow systems.
  • Familiarity with regulated industries such as financial services, banking, healthcare, or other compliance-driven environments.
  • Knowledge of compliance frameworks, including SOC 2, NIST CSF, or similar regulatory standards.
  • Ability to influence technical strategy, drive alignment across teams, and navigate ambiguous problem spaces with sound engineering judgment.
